,可以通过以下步骤完成:
from django.db import models
class User(models.Model):
name = models.CharField(max_length=100)
groups = models.ManyToManyField('Group')
def __str__(self):
return self.name
class Group(models.Model):
name = models.CharField(max_length=100)
def __str__(self):
return self.name
在上面的例子中,User模型中的groups字段是一个ManyToMany字段,它关联到Group模型。
user = User.objects.get(id=1) # 假设用户ID为1
groups = user.groups.all()
上述代码中,首先通过User.objects.get()方法获取到ID为1的用户对象,然后通过user.groups.all()获取到该用户所属的所有组。
注意:以上链接仅为示例,实际应根据具体情况选择合适的腾讯云产品。
通过以上步骤,可以从表单Django中的ManyToMany字段检索数据,并了解到相关的概念、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址。
云+社区沙龙online[数据工匠]
云+社区沙龙online[数据工匠]
云+社区技术沙龙[第7期]
T-Day
Elastic 中国开发者大会
Elastic Meetup Online 第一期
企业创新在线学堂
企业创新在线学堂
Elastic 中国开发者大会
领取专属 10元无门槛券
手把手带您无忧上云